首页 > 其他分享 >解决浏览器input文本框显示账号密码问题

解决浏览器input文本框显示账号密码问题

时间:2023-05-25 14:14:10浏览次数:40  
标签:浏览器 name 填充 文本框 input 账号密码

系统里有个搜索框,搜索框是input type="text"的标签,不知为何,始终会显示登录后的用户名在里面。

虽然浏览器开启了自动填充,但是这个文本框的name也不是登录框的name,也不是密码框,但是依然自动填充了。

这个问题困扰了我很久。可能是浏览器的bug?

尝试了多种方法都无法解决,后来经过研究,这个搜索框是html文档的第一个文本框,猜测浏览器会将内容自动填充到第一个文本框,就加了如下代码,果然解决了。

<body>
    <!-- 解决浏览器自动填充问题 -->
    <input type='text' style='display:none'>
    <input type='text' autocomplete='off' style="display:none;"/>
    <input type='password' autocomplete='new-password' style="display:none;"/>
</body>

将以上代码放到<body>第一个位置处,input设置隐藏。

 

标签:浏览器,name,填充,文本框,input,账号密码
From: https://www.cnblogs.com/jsper/p/17431016.html

相关文章

  • el-input的input和change事件区别
    inputinput是在输入值变化后就会触发changechange是在输入值变化并且失去焦点或用户按Enter时触发。与blur事件有着相似的功能,但与blur事件不同的是,change事件在输入框的值未改变时并不会触发blur不管输入值是否变化,只要失去焦点就会触发......
  • html中的input框中的value值到底是什么
    input框中的value值到底是什么,value属性为input元素设定值。对于不同的输入类型,value属性的用法也不同:type="button","reset","submit"-定义按钮上的显示的文本type="text","password","hidden"-定义输入字段的初始值type="checkbox","r......
  • 解决使用输入法输入在 React input 框中的问题
    问题在使用React绑定input输入框的onChange方法时,如果使用中文输入法(或者其他输入法),会出现一个问题:还在输入拼音的时候,onChange方法已经触发了,如下,即输入过程就已经触发了多次onChange方法。如果onChange方法有较为复杂的逻辑,就可能会带来一些用户体验或者逻辑的问题。......
  • Failed to execute 'setSelectionRange' on 'HTMLInputElement'
    jcubic commented on7Jan2016WhenIusenumberinputI'vegoterrorinGoogleChromeUncaughtInvalidStateError:Failedtoexecute'setSelectionRange'on'HTMLInputElement':Theinputelement'stype('number')......
  • python内置库--fileinput
    1关于fileinput利用fileinput,我们可以循环遍历标准输入或者多个文件中的数据它和open()作用很类似,但是open()只能操作一个文件且相关函数功能没有它丰富2函数介绍fileinput.input(files=None,inplace=False,backup='',*,mode='r',openhook=None,encoding=None,error......
  • 求教一个问题,关于elementplus的el-input-number组件问题
    问题描述:我想让组件默认展示placeholder的值,但是他默认显示的是0,网上搜到的方法都是说将默认值设成undefined,但是我试了并不好用问题代码如下: <el-input-numberv-model="state.form.throwTargetNum"class="range-input":......
  • 在input中如何禁止复制、粘贴、鼠标右键弹出面板选项
    主要事件右键弹出面板选项oncontextmenu复制oncopy粘贴onpaste原生input实现-禁止复制<inputoncopy="returnfalse"/>-禁止粘贴<inputonpaste="returnfalse"/>-禁止鼠标右键弹出面板选项<inputoncontextmenu="returnfalse"/>Rea......
  • Python学习之七_input和print
    Python学习之七_input和print摘要python3之后函数必须带()了因为我开始学习的比较晚,所以准备Python3开始学起前面主要是模仿别人的代码进行学习后续慢慢学习使用python调用ebpf等内容.这里简单先总结一下input和print的函数.作为一个学习总结print和inputprint......
  • el-input 控制输入内容只能输金额
    formatValue(value,row,item){letval=(value&&value.split(""))||[];letsNum=val.toString();//先转换成字符串类型if(sNum.indexOf('.')===0){//第一位就是.sNum='0'+sNum}sNum......
  • vue中光标显示到指定的input框内
    给input标签内加ref="inputName"然后在想要执行的地方写this.$refs.inputName.focus() 1.如果想要打开这个页面的时让光标自动显示到input框内就在mounted里加 2.如果想在执行事件之后让光标显示到input框内就加在事件里 ......